      • Profile picture of the author eholmlund
        Originally Posted by Droopy Dawg View Post

        Wow... so doing a typical product launch... and "sprinkle in" some of the BFM techniques for the long-term... should be a pretty good strategy.

        I'd say that's correct. BM sites and full blown product launches are by no means mutually exclusive. You could certainly to a "typical" launch with a BM site, and get the benefits of both strategies.

        One of the very first features of the BM script was the built in affiliate program. This could be very effective during a product launch, because your customers are instantly presented with their own affiliate link, so they can turn around and promote the launch too.

  • Profile picture of the author RichardLegg
    Like Eric, I actually paid $1000 for it when it first launched. That was a LOT of money for me back then (I was a full time college student so not exactly 'flush' with cash).

    It was honestly one of the best investments for my business.

    Just a couple of my sites have made me well over 6 figures in upfront sales (not counting backend sales and promos to the list) and generated over 50,000 members.

    I'm still getting an average of 40-50 optins per day from a couple of sites I haven't touched in months - if not longer.

    Just buying the software isn't going to make you rich. You have to apply the concepts and use the script effectively, but as a tool, it's been invaluable to me.
